Figures 4-4 and 4-5 show a bias resistor connected between ACH0– and the 
floating signal source ground. This resistor provides a return path for the 
±200 pA bias current. A value of 10 k
Ω to 100 kΩ is usually sufficient. 
If you do not use the resistor and the source is truly floating, the source is 
not likely to remain within the common-mode signal range of the PGIA, 
and the PGIA saturates, causing erroneous readings. You must reference 
the source to the respective channel ground.
Common-mode rejection might be improved by using another bias resistor 
from the ACH0+ input to ACH0GND. This connection gives a slight 
measurement error due to the voltage divider formed with the output 
impedance of the floating source, but it also gives a more balanced input for 
better common-mode rejection.
Common-Mode Signal Rejection Considerations
Figures 4-2 and  4-3 show connections for signal sources that are already 
referenced to some ground point with respect to the NI 6115/6120. In 
theory, the PGIA can reject any voltage caused by ground-potential 
differences between the signal source and the device. In addition, with 
pseudodifferential input connections, the PGIA can reject common-mode 
noise pickup in the leads connecting the signal sources to the device.
